Key Features for Artist Development
When using Spotify for Artists regularly, the app provides comprehensive audience insights that break down listener demographics by age, gender, location, and listening habits. You’ll see which playlists are driving discovery, how individual tracks perform over time, and where your music gains traction globally. These analytics update continuously, giving you actionable data for tour routing, marketing decisions, and content strategy across all your audio content.
- Real-time streaming counts showing current active listeners worldwide
- Detailed song and playlist performance metrics with historical trend analysis
- Audience demographic breakdowns including geographic distribution and listener retention rates
- Playlist addition notifications alerting you when curators feature your music
- Follower milestone tracking with growth rate indicators
- Canvas upload functionality for adding short looping visuals to individual tracks
- Multi-artist account switching for managers and labels overseeing multiple rosters
Profile Management and Creative Control
You control your artist presence through direct profile editing capabilities within Spotify for Artists. The interface lets you update your bio, select featured tracks through Artist Pick, curate your public playlists, and upload profile images without requiring desktop access. When you add Canvas visuals to your tracks, these 3-8 second looping videos appear during playback on both iOS and Android devices, creating a more immersive listening experience that can increase save rates and engagement.
The multi-artist switching feature proves essential for managers, labels, and artists with side projects. You can toggle between different artist profiles instantly, monitoring stats and making updates across your entire roster from a single login. Each profile maintains separate analytics, notifications, and customization options, creating an efficient workflow environment for users managing multiple acts.
Use Cases for Independent and Signed Artists
Independent musicians use Spotify for Artists to identify which cities show strong listener concentration before booking tours. The geographic data reveals untapped markets and confirms where promotional efforts are working. When a track gets added to an editorial or algorithmic playlist, you receive immediate notifications with performance tracking to measure the playlist’s impact on your overall streams.
Label teams and artist managers rely on the platform for A&R decisions and release strategy. The comparative analytics show how new releases perform against catalog tracks, which songs drive profile visits, and how listener retention changes over album cycles. You can share specific stats screenshots directly from the app to communicate performance with collaborators and stakeholders, maintaining a transparent balance between creative and commercial objectives.
Expert Insight: Understanding Spotify’s Data Architecture
Spotify for Artists pulls data from Spotify’s streaming infrastructure, which processes over 100,000 tracks uploaded daily according to industry reports from the International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I). The platform’s analytics engine aggregates listening behavior across more than 500 million users globally, providing artists with near-instantaneous feedback on performance metrics.
The technical implementation uses a combination of batch processing for historical data and stream processing for real-time metrics. When users stream your tracks, the data flows through Spotify’s event pipeline, which categorizes listening sessions by completion rate, skip behavior, and playlist context. This granular approach means Spotify for Artists can show you not just how many streams you received, but the quality of engagement—whether listeners saved your track, added it to their own playlists, or included it in their regular rotation.
The Canvas feature utilizes MP4 video files optimized for mobile bandwidth, with specific technical requirements: 720×720 pixel resolution, 3-8 second duration, and file sizes under 10MB. These specifications ensure smooth playback across varying network conditions while maintaining visual quality on iPhone, Android, and tablet devices.
